Explore the Thrills of Crocodile Watching and River Safari in Matara

Crocodile Watching and River Safari in Matara offers a unique opportunity to experience the thrill of observing crocodiles in their natural habitat. Nestled within the lush landscapes of Sri Lanka, this destination invites tourists to embark on an exhilarating boat tour along the tranquil rivers that weave through the region. As you glide through the waters, your expert guides will share fascinating stories about the local wildlife and the delicate ecosystem that supports it. The safari not only focuses on crocodiles but also presents a chance to witness a variety of bird species and other wildlife that inhabit the riverbanks. Each tour is a perfect blend of adventure and educational insight, making it an ideal outing for families, nature enthusiasts, and anyone looking to connect with the wild side of Sri Lanka. The serene yet thrilling atmosphere allows visitors to capture stunning photographs, creating lasting memories of their time spent here. The best time to visit is during the early morning or late afternoon when wildlife is most active. With the sun casting a golden glow over the water, your chances of spotting these magnificent reptiles are at their peak. Be prepared for an unforgettable experience that not only showcases the beauty of Sri Lanka's natural heritage but also promotes conservation and awareness of its unique wildlife. Whether you're an avid explorer or just seeking a memorable day out, the Crocodile Watching and River Safari is an adventure that should not be missed.

Local tips

  • Book your tour in advance, especially during peak season, to secure your spot.
  • Bring a pair of binoculars for better wildlife viewing and photography.
  • Wear comfortable clothing and sunscreen, as you'll be out on the water for an extended period.
  • Visit early in the morning or late afternoon for the best chance to see crocodiles and other wildlife.
  • Listen closely to your guide for interesting facts and stories about the local ecosystem.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from the center of Matara, head southeast on Matara – Beliatta Road (A2) for about 2 kilometers. Continue to follow the A2 until you reach a junction near the Matara Bus Station. Take a left onto Kamburugamuwa Road. After approximately 1.5 kilometers, you will see signs for Crocodile Watching and River Safari. Turn right onto the road leading to the attraction, which will lead you directly to the parking area.

  • Public Transportation (Bus)

    From the Matara Bus Station, take a local bus heading toward Kamburugamuwa. Buses are frequent and cost around 30 LKR. Inform the conductor you want to go to Crocodile Watching and River Safari. The bus will drop you off near the entrance of the attraction, about a 5-minute walk away. Follow the signs to reach the entrance.

  • Tuk-Tuk

    For a more comfortable ride, consider taking a tuk-tuk from your location in Matara. You can negotiate the fare, which typically ranges from 300 to 500 LKR based on your starting point. The driver will take you directly to Crocodile Watching and River Safari Matara.
